Precisely. The renderer can choose to render both lines as double at middle zooms, which will come out as two double lines virtually on top of one another (so all you'll see is one double line).
At about z17, the renderer would probably choose to render them as two single lines, and they'd come out next to one another. At z18 there'd probably be a gap between the lines. Any views on whether it should be a separate tag, or included in the proposed tracks tag?
